How to automatically email new Paddle subscribers

Relay.app is an automation tool that lets you automate actions across Gmail, Paddle, and many other apps. In this guide, we'll show you how to use Relay.app to automatically run the GmailSend email” action for each PaddleSubscription created” event.

Add a Paddle "Subscription created" trigger

After creating a new playbook, click "Add trigger" and then select "Subscription created" under the Paddle menu item. Triggers detect changes in your connected apps and run your playbook in response.

With the "Subscription created" trigger, Relay.app will automatically detect newly created subscriptions in Paddle and kick off a new run of this playbook.

Add a Gmail "Send email" step

Click the "Add step" button, and then select "Send email" under Gmail. Next, fill in the email fields like recipient and message body. Here you can use data from the Paddle trigger that kicked off the run.

If your Gmail account isn't already connected to Relay.app, you will be prompted to connect it. Just follow the prompts to allow Relay.app to sync with your Gmail account.

Activate your Relay.app playbook

Activating your playbook is the final step. Once turned on, Relay.app will respond to each new Paddle subscription by creating an email message via Gmail, without you needing to lift another finger.

To enable your playbook, just click the toggle button located in the header. You'll also generally want to perform a test run of any new playbook to check that its configured properly and working smoothly.
